Automating VPS Security: Tools and Scripts to Consider

Automating VPS Security: Tools and Scripts to Consider


Publisher: DJ Technologies
Date: 2025/2026

In an era where cyber threats are increasingly sophisticated, securing your Virtual Private server (VPS) is more critical than ever. As businesses rely more on VPS for hosting applications and storing sensitive data, the need for robust, automated security measures is paramount. Here, we explore the tools and scripts that can help you automate VPS security, ensuring that your digital assets stay safe while you focus on driving your business forward.

Understanding VPS Security

A Virtual Private server provides the benefits of a dedicated server while sharing the physical hardware with other virtual servers. This offers both advantages and challenges in terms of security. While VPS users have more control over their environments compared to shared hosting, they are still vulnerable to various cyber threats such as DDoS attacks, malware, and unauthorized access.

Why Automate Security?

Automating security tasks allows for real-time protection and minimizes human error. With automation, organizations can implement consistent security protocols, making it easier to monitor and respond to potential threats. Here are some key benefits of automating VPS security:

  • Efficiency: Automate repetitive tasks, freeing up resources for strategic decision-making.
  • Real-time Monitoring: Continuous monitoring of your VPS environment helps detect and respond to threats immediately.
  • Consistency: Enforce uniform security measures across your infrastructure to minimize vulnerabilities.

Key Tools and Scripts for Automating VPS Security

  1. Fail2Ban
    Fail2Ban is an open-source intrusion prevention software framework that protects your VPS from brute-force attacks. It scans log files for suspicious activity and automatically bans IP addresses that show malicious signs. You can customize it to cover various services like SSH, FTP, and web servers.

  2. Uncomplicated Firewall (UFW)
    UFW is a user-friendly interface for managing iptables firewall settings. You’ll have the ability to enable or disable services easily and create rules for automatic updates. This helps in protecting your VPS from unauthorized access.

  3. rkhunter and chkrootkit
    These tools are essential for scanning your VPS for rootkits, which are malicious software designed to gain unauthorized access to your system. Automating scheduled scans helps keep your VPS clean and secure.

  4. ClamAV
    ClamAV is an open-source antivirus engine designed for detecting malware. Automate daily or weekly scans to ensure that your server isn’t hosting any malicious files or software.

  5. OSSEC
    OSSEC is a host-based intrusion detection system (HIDS) that provides real-time log analysis and monitoring. It can automatically send alerts for suspicious activities, helping you stay one step ahead of potential threats.

  6. Backup Scripts
    Implementing automated backup solutions is vital for restoring your VPS in case of a security breach. Use scripts to schedule regular backups of your data to a secure, off-site location.

  7. Security Updates Automation
    Configure your VPS to automatically install security updates for the operating system and applications. This minimizes the risk of vulnerabilities being exploited before you can take action.

  8. Let’s Encrypt
    Use Let’s Encrypt to automate SSL certificate issuance and renewal. Secure your data in transit by encrypting traffic between your server and its users, which is essential in there’s an increase in data breaches.

Best Practices for Implementation

  • Monitor Activity Logs: Continuously review activity logs to identify patterns or anomalies that require attention.
  • Set Up Alerts: Use automated notifications to flag unusual activities, enabling you to respond faster.
  • Regular Reviews: Regularly assess your security measures to ensure they are up to date and effective.
  • User Education: Train your staff on cybersecurity awareness to minimize human error, which can often be the weakest link in your security chain.

Conclusion

As cyber threats continue to evolve, automating VPS security measures is no longer an option but a necessity. By implementing the right tools and scripts, you can enhance your VPS security posture, protect sensitive data, and maintain the integrity of your operations. At DJ Technologies, we are committed to providing you with the latest insights and solutions to navigate the complex world of cybersecurity. In 2025 and beyond, prioritizing automated security will be key to thriving in the digital landscape.


For more information on how DJ Technologies can help you secure your VPS, contact us today!

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*

This site uses Akismet to reduce spam. Learn how your comment data is processed.